My offseason pipe dream with Stanton limiting his teams to NYY and LAD...

Stanton goes to LA. LA now needs to move Puig or risk platooning/benching him and losing his focus. SF missed out on their OF solution and turns back to Cutch. Move Cutch to SF for Panik and Steven Dugger (which allows Harrison to move to 3B full-time and lets Fraizer focus on being the 4th OF and emergency 2B with Moroff backing up at 2B) while also not having to rush Meadows if he's not ready (or hurt again).

Then, the real pipe dream begins... snatch up Puig and all of his $9.2m for 2018. Overall still saves money and doesn't leave any massive holes.

Marte, Polanco, Puig would be an extremely fun OF to watch. I would be tempted to have the best corner OF defense in the world with Marte and Puig while letting Polanco try to be an average CF, but I think Marte would end up in CF again and I'm not sure how I'd split up the corners with Coffee and Puig.

Like I said, pipe dream, but fingers crossed.

Marlins have already said Yelich is untouchable. Has a reasonable contract until his age 30 season, so I doubt they're bluffing on that. 2020 would be the earliest I could see them looking to move him ($9.7m to $12.7m to $14m then $15m), should their finances not change much.

Not to mention the haul that the Marlins would need to part with him. $7m this season and entering his prime. They're not desperate to move that small of salary for nothing.
